May be but not: Related. Hla b 27b is one of the antigens normally present, though it is associated with some inflammatory diseases, most notably ankylosing spondylitis.See this site for more information on this topic. http://emedicine.medscape.com/article/1201027-overview.

BY CHANCE ALONE-?: 7-8% of the caucasian population is b27+. 2.5% of african-americans are b27+. The rarity of ALS is such that there has been no association defined. So 1/13 to 1/14 patients ( if caucasian) will be b27 positive. However, 1/3 b27+ patients have rheumatic issues, which might complicate the life-threatening ALS disease!
